LEDiL LEILA Series LED Lenses


The LEILA series from LEDil, are a family of round LED lens assemblies with a black or white PC holder. This range is designed for use with a single LED and come in a wide variety of options including clear or diffused. They also offer a range of round beam angles from a spot to extra wide, and even an oval and rectangular beam option. LEILA lenses direct the light from an LED light source through the lens to achieve the desired beam emission type with a uniform output.

Made using an optical grade PMMA, the LEILA lenses offer a high UV and temperature resistance.

LEILA lenses have been designed and optimised for use with a variety of LEDs. Due to the rapidly changing nature of LED products customers are strongly advised to consult the latest manufacturer data for compatible LEDs.
